22.4.29 print-not-readable | Condition Type |
---|
Class Precedence List:
print-not-readable,error,serious-condition,condition,t
Description:
The type print-not-readable consists of error conditions that occur during output while *print-readably* is true, as a result of attempting to write a printed representation with the _Lisp printer_that would not be correctly read back with the Lisp reader. The object which could not be printed is initialized by the :object initialization argument to make-condition, and is accessed by the function print-not-readable-object.
